Hill le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s terrain or foundation to ensure it is even and properly aligned. This process typically includes grading the land, filling in low spots, and removing excess soil or debris to create a stable, flat surface. Properly leveled land helps prevent water pooling, reduces soil erosion, and provides a solid base for construction, landscaping, or driveway installation.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to achieve a consistent, durable result that enhances both the functionality and appearance of a property.
These services are particularly valuable for addressing common problems such as uneven yard surfaces, water drainage issues, or shifting foundations. When a property experiences frequent pooling of water after rain, or if the ground appears to be sinking or tilting, hill leveling can correct these issues by re-establishing a proper slope. This not only improves the safety and usability of outdoor spaces but also helps protect the structural integrity of nearby buildings. The overview below groups typical Hill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Summerfield,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for routine leveling of minor uneven areas. Many local contractors handle these straightforward jobs within this range, which covers most small-scale projects.
Moderate Leveling - projects involving larger sections or more extensive adjustments usually fall between $600 and $1,500. These are common for residential properties needing moderate corrections.
Significant Resurfacing - larger, more complex projects such as driveway or foundation adjustments can cost $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, but they are necessary for major corrections.
Full Replacement - complete replacement of existing structures or extensive foundation work can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ve substantial structural work by spec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is hill leveling? Hill leveling involves adjusting the elevation of uneven terrain to create a more stable and level surface, often to prepare for construction or landscaping projects in Summerfield, FL.
Why should I consider hill leveling services? Hill leveling can improve land stability, prevent erosion, and provide a safer, more functional outdoor space by addressing uneven ground conditions with the help of local contractors.
What types of equipment do local service providers use for hill leveling? They typically use heavy machinery such as bulldozers, graders, and excavators to efficiently reshape and level the terrain.
How do local contractors determine the best approach for hill leveling? They evaluate the land's current condition, slope, and drainage needs to develop a plan suited to the specific terrain and project goals.
Can hill leveling be combined with other land improvement services? Yes, many local service providers also offer grading, drainage solutions, and landscaping to enhance land usability after leveling is completed.
